/** * Reads 2 compressed longs from buf into seqnos * <p/> * Once variable-length encoding has been implemented, this method will probably get dropped as we can simply * read the 2 longs individually. * @param buf the buffer to read from * @param seqnos the array to read the seqnos into, needs to have a length of 2 */ public static void readLongSequence(ByteBuffer buf, long seqnos[]) { byte len=buf.get(); if(len == 0) { seqnos[0]=seqnos[1]=0; return; } byte len1=firstNibble(len), len2=secondNibble(len); seqnos[0]=makeLong(buf, len1); seqnos[1]=makeLong(buf, len2) + seqnos[0]; }
/** * Reads 2 compressed longs into an array of 2 longs. * <p/> * Once variable-length encoding has been implemented, this method will probably get dropped as we can simply * read the 2 longs individually. * @param in the input stream to read from * @param seqnos the array to read the seqnos into, needs to have a length of 2 * @param index the index of the first element to be written; the seqnos are written to seqnos[index] and seqnos[index+1] */ public static void readLongSequence(DataInput in, long[] seqnos, int index) throws IOException { byte len=in.readByte(); if(len == 0) { seqnos[index]=seqnos[index+1]=0; return; } byte len1=firstNibble(len), len2=secondNibble(len); seqnos[index]=makeLong(in, len1); seqnos[index+1]=makeLong(in, len2) + seqnos[index]; }
